Home window replacement services involve removing existing windows and installing new ones to enhance a property's app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ency. This process typically includes carefully measuring the opening, selecting appropriate window styles, and ensuring proper installation to achieve a seamless fit. The goal is to improve the overall look of a building while providing better insulation and reducing drafts, which can lead to lower energy bills and increased comfort for occupants.
These services address several common problems associated with older or damaged windows. Over time, windows can become drafty, difficult to operate, or visually outdated. They may also develop issues such as cracked glass, warping frames, or leaks that compromise the integrity of the building. Replacing windows can help eliminate these issues, resulting in a more secure and weather-resistant property. Additionally, new windows can reduce noise infiltration and improve the overall security of a home or commercial space.

Average Cost Range - Home window replacement services typically cost between $300 and $800 per window, depending on size, style, and materials. For example, a standard double-hung window might be around $400, while custom or larger windows can reach $1,000 or more.
Factors Influencing Costs - The total expense varies based on window type, frame material, and installation complexity. Vinyl windows tend to be more affordable, whereas wood or custom options may increase the price significantly.
Installation Fees - Labor costs for window replacement generally range from $150 to $500 per window. These fees depend on the number of windows, accessibility, and local labor rates in Perkasie, PA and surrounding areas.
Additional Expenses - Costs for removal of old windows, disposal, and any necessary repairs can add $50 to $200 per window. Contact local pros to get a detailed estimate tailored to specific project requ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
